Like the other Senufo languages, Nafaanra has three contrastive tones: High, Mid and Low. Tone is normally not marked in the Nafaanra orthography. Examples are:[16]

kúfɔ̀ "yam" (High-Low)
dama "two pesewas (coin)" (Mid)
màŋà "rope" (Low)
